mentorship Guidelines
1. Choose a mentor
Read the mentor’s description and decide if this person is the right mentor to help you achieve your goal.
2. Request Online Meeting
Press the “Request” button and fill out a simple questionnaire, upload supporting documents, and provide your availability.
3. Confirm Appointment
You will receive an email within 3-5 business days regarding your request status. Confirm your 15-30 min time slot to receive an online meeting link.
4. Be Prepared
Make sure that you have a clear goal of what you want to get out of the mentoring session and ask specific questions. Think about why you want to talk to this specific mentor instead of getting the answer from a quick Google search.
5. Show up on time
Show up 5-10 min in advance to the online session. Submit materials prior, come prepared with questions, and keep your case concise and to the point.
6. Leave a review
Don’t forget to thank your mentor for their time, follow up, and leave them a good review to help future mentee make easier choices. Request for another appointment at least 2 weeks later.
